基于单波段的火焰检测方法及装置的制造方法

文档序号:10513144阅读:171来源:国知局
基于单波段的火焰检测方法及装置的制造方法
【专利摘要】本发明提供了基于单波段的火焰探测方法,该方法包括:采集经过滤光处理后的滤光图像;对滤光图像进行帧间分析,获取候选区域;对候选区域进行筛选;将剩余的候选区域作为火焰检测图像并输出。与现有技术相比,本发明的火焰检测方法及装置具有更好的实用性。
【专利说明】
基于单波段的火焰检测方法及装置
技术领域
[0001] 本发明涉及图像处理、视频监控以及消防,特别涉及单波段的火焰检测方法及装 置。
【背景技术】
[0002] 随着消防领域火灾检测技术的发展,基于视频的火焰检测方法以其高效、准确、不 易受环境因素干扰等优点,成为业内研究的主流技术。
[0003] 公开号为CN104469312A的中国发明专利申请公开了一种基于视觉的火灾探测装 置及其探测方法,通过在图像传感器光路中加入偏振镜片、高通滤光片、低通滤光片,再通 过数字滤波、亮度检测,判断火焰产生。公开号为CN104318700A的中国发明专利申请公开了 一种双波段视频双核火灾探测器及其前端装置,采用彩色视频图像和特定波段的红外火焰 图像融合识别火焰。然而,上述火焰探测技术在复杂环境中检测率较低。
[0004] 综上所述,目前迫切需要提出一种能有效地在复杂环境中检测火焰的方法及装 置。

【发明内容】

[0005] 有鉴于此,本发明的主要目的在于实现有效地在复杂环境中检测火焰。
[0006]为达到上述目的,按照本发明的第一个方面,提供了基于单波段的火焰检测方法, 该方法包括:
[0007] 第一步骤,采集经过滤光处理后的滤光图像;
[0008] 第二步骤,对滤光图像进行帧间分析,获取候选区域;
[0009] 第三步骤,对候选区域进行筛选;
[0010] 第四步骤,将剩余的候选区域作为火焰检测图像并输出。
[0011]所述第二步骤中帧差分析包括:
[0012] 对前后两帧图像做帧差处理,获得帧差图像;
[0013] 设置阈值TH_FD,对帧差图像进行二值化处理,得到一系列的帧差二值化图像; [0014]选择TM个连续的帧差二值化图像做"与"操作,得到融合的帧差二值化图像;
[0015] 对融合的帧差二值化图像进行连通区域处理,获得一系列连通区域,即为候选区 域。
[0016] 所述第三步骤中对候选区域进行筛选包括:
[0017] 面积筛选步骤,计算候选区域的面积,滤除面积小于阈值TH_CR的候选区域;
[0018] 移动速率筛选步骤,计算候选区域的水平移动速率vdP垂直移动速率Vy,滤除
[0019] 其中,所述面积筛选步骤中计算候选区域的面积,即统计候选区域内的像素点的 个数。
[0020] 所述移动速率筛选步骤中计算候选区域的水平移动速率vjP垂直移动速率vy具体 如下:
[0021]对于相邻两帧图像中候选区域€〇1(1,7)、€〇2(1,7),分别计算€〇1(1,7)、€〇2(1,7)

[0023] fDi(x,y)、fD2(x,y)分别为相邻两帧图像中候选区域(x,y)的亮度值,M、N分别为候 选区域的长度和宽度;
[0025]按照本发明的另一个方面,提供了基于单波段的火焰检测装置,该装置包括:
[0026]采集模块,用于采集经过滤光处理后的滤光图像;
[0027] 候选区域获取模块,用于对滤光图像进行帧间分析,获取候选区域;
[0028] 候选区域筛选模块,用于对候选区域进行筛选;
[0029]火焰检测图像获取模块,用于将剩余的候选区域作为火焰检测图像并输出。
[0030] 所述采集模块包括相机和滤光元件,滤光元件安装在相机的镜头和CCD之间。
[0031] 所述候选区域获取模块中帧差分析包括:
[0032] 帧差处理模块,用于对前后两帧图像做帧差处理,获得帧差图像;
[0033]二值化处理模块,用于设置阈值TH_FD,对帧差图像进行二值化处理,得到一系列 的帧差二值化图像;
[0034]图像融合模块,用于选择TM个连续的帧差二值化图像做"与"操作,得到融合的帧 差二值化图像;
[0035]连通区域处理模块,用于对融合的帧差二值化图像进行连通区域处理,获得一系 列连通区域,即为候选区域。
[0036] 所述候选区域筛选模块中对候选区域进行筛选包括:
[0037] 面积筛选模块,用于计算候选区域的面积,滤除面积小于阈值TH_CR的候选区域;
[0038] 移动速率筛选模块,用于计算候选区域的水平移动速率^和垂直移动速率Vy,滤除 腸刀_厂酣]或者'',4々」< ,,m,7H]的候选区域。
[0039] 其中,所述面积筛选模块中计算候选区域的面积,即统计候选区域内的像素点的 个数。
[0040] 所述移动速率筛选模块中计算候选区域的水平移动速率vjP垂直移动速率^包 括:
[0041]质心获取模块,对于相邻两帧图像中候选区域fDi(x,y)、fD2(x,y),分别计算fDi (叉,7)、^)2(叉,7)的质心(父1,¥ 1)、(父2,¥2),公式为:
[0043]
,.fDi(x,y)、fD2(x,y)分别为相邻两帧图像中候选区域(x, y)的亮度值,M、N分别为候选区域的长度和宽度
[0044] 移动速率计算模块,计算候选区域的水平移动速率
和垂直移动速率
[0045] 与现有的图像型火焰检测技术相比,本发明的基于单波段的火焰检测方法及装置 可以检测出复杂场景中的火焰,实用性较高。
【附图说明】
[0046] 图1示出了按照本发明的基于单波段的火焰检测方法的流程图。
[0047] 图2示出了按照本发明的基于单波段的火焰检测装置的框架图。
【具体实施方式】
[0048] 为使贵审查员能进一步了解本发明的结构、特征及其他目的,现结合所附较佳实 施例详细说明如下,所说明的较佳实施例仅用于说明本发明的技术方案,并非限定本发明。
[0049] 图1给出了按照本发明的基于单波段的火焰检测方法的流程图。如图1所示,按照 本发明的基于单波段的火焰检测方法包括:
[0050] 第一步骤S1,采集经过滤光处理后的滤光图像;
[0051] 第二步骤S2,对滤光图像进行帧间分析,获取候选区域;
[0052]第三步骤S3,对候选区域进行筛选;
[0053]第四步骤S4,将剩余的候选区域作为火焰检测图像并输出。
[0054] 所述第一步骤S1中滤光处理的滤光波段为TH_WF,TH_WF的取值范围为760~ 900nm。优选地,TH_WF设置为880nm。
[0055]所述第二步骤S2中帧差分析包括:
[0050]步骤S21,对前后两帧图像做帧差处理,获得帧差图像;
[0057]步骤S22,设置阈值TH_FD,对帧差图像进行二值化处理,得到一系列的帧差二值化 图像;
[0058]步骤S23,选择TM个连续的帧差二值化图像做"与"操作,得到融合的帧差二值化图 像;
[0059]步骤S24,对融合的帧差二值化图像进行连通区域处理,获得一系列连通区域,即 为候选区域。
[0060] 其中,步骤S22中TH_ro的取值范围为5~30。优选地,TH_ro设置为18。步骤S23中的 TM取值范围为5~30。优选地,TM设置为15。
[0061 ]所述第三步骤S3中对候选区域进行筛选包括:
[0062] 面积筛选步骤S31,计算候选区域的面积,滤除面积小于阈值TH_CR的候选区域;
[0063] 移动速率筛选步骤S32,计算候选区域的水平移动速率vjP垂直移动速率vy,滤除 V,pK聊,% J或者匕.47?-K_,厂[_4J的候选区域。
[0064] 其中,所述面积筛选步骤S31中计算候选区域的面积,即统计候选区域内的像素点 的个数。TH_CR的取值范围为20~40。优选地,TH_CR设置为30。
[0065] 所述移动速率筛选步骤S32中计算候选区域的水平移动速率vjP垂直移动速率vy 具体如下:
[0066]步骤3321,对于相邻两帧图像中候选区域€〇1(1,7)、€〇2(1,7),分别计算€〇1(1,7)、

[0068] fDi(x,y)、fD2(x,y)分别为相邻两帧图像中候选区域(x,y)的亮度值,M、N分别为候
选区域的长度和宽度;
[0069] 步骤S322,计算候选区域的水平移动速率 和垂直移动速率
[0070] 所述移动速率筛选步骤S32中Th_Vmir^PTh_VmaxS设定的阈值,Th_V min的取值范围 为0.1 ~0.3,Th_Vmax的取值范围为0.3 ~0.6,且Th_Vmin< Th_Vmax。
[0071] 图2给出了按照本发明的基于单波段的火焰检测装置的框架图。如图2所示,按照 本发明的基于单波段的火焰检测装置包括:
[0072]采集模块1,用于采集经过滤光处理后的滤光图像;
[0073]候选区域获取模块2,用于对滤光图像进行帧间分析,获取候选区域;
[0074]候选区域筛选模块3,用于对候选区域进行筛选;
[0075]火焰检测图像获取模块4,用于将剩余的候选区域作为火焰检测图像并输出。
[0076] 所述采集模块1包括相机和滤光元件,滤光元件安装在相机的镜头和CCD之间。滤 光元件为能实现滤光功能的元件,诸如滤光片、滤光器、滤光设备等。其中,滤光元件的滤光 波段为TH_WF,TH_WF的取值范围为760~900nm。优选地,TH_WF设置为880nm〇
[0077] 所述候选区域获取模块2中帧差分析包括:
[0078]帧差处理模块21,用于对前后两帧图像做帧差处理,获得帧差图像;
[0079]二值化处理模块22,用于设置阈值TH_FD,对帧差图像进行二值化处理,得到一系 列的帧差二值化图像;
[0080] 图像融合模块23,用于选择TM个连续的帧差二值化图像做"与"操作,得到融合的 帧差二值化图像;
[0081] 连通区域处理模块24,用于对融合的帧差二值化图像进行连通区域处理,获得一 系列连通区域,即为候选区域。
[0082] 其中,所述二值化处理模块22中ΤΗ_Π )的取值范围为5~30。优选地,ΤΗ_Π )设置为 18。图像融合模块S23中的ΤΜ取值范围为5~30。优选地,ΤΜ设置为15。
[0083] 所述候选区域筛选模块3中对候选区域进行筛选包括:
[0084] 面积筛选模块31,用于计算候选区域的面积,滤除面积小于阈值TH_CR的候选区 域;
[0085] 移动速率筛选模块32,用于计算候选区域的水平移动速率^和垂直移动速率vy,滤 除、,\ 酬,巧-^1或者…的候选区域。
[0086] 其中,所述面积筛选模块31中计算候选区域的面积,即统计候选区域内的像素点 的个数。TH_CR的取值范围为20~40。优选地,TH_CR设置为30。
[0087] 所述移动速率筛选模块32中计算候选区域的水平移动速率^和垂直移动速率^包 括:
[0088]质心获取模块321,对于相邻两帧图像中候选区域€01(^7)402&, 7),分别计算 仰1(叉,7)、^)2(叉,7)的质心(父 1,¥1)、(父2,¥2),公式为:
[0090]
4〇1(1,7)、€〇2(1,7)分别为相邻两帧图像中候选区域(义,7) 的亮度值,M、N分别为候选区域的长度和宽度;
[0091] 移动速率计算模块322,计算候选区域的水平移动速率
和垂直移动速
[0092] 所述移动速率筛选模块32中Th_Vmir^PTh_VmaA设定的阈值,Th_V min的取值范围为 0.1 ~0.3,Th_Vmax的取值范围为0.3 ~0.6,且Th_Vmin< Th_Vmax。
[0093] 与现有的图像型火焰检测技术相比,本发明的基于单波段的火焰检测方法及装置 可以检测出复杂场景中的火焰,实用性较高。
[0094] 以上所述,仅为本发明的较佳实施例而已,并非用于限定本发明的保护范围,应当 理解,本发明并不限于这里所描述的实现方案,这些实现方案描述的目的在于帮助本领域 中的技术人员实践本发明。任何本领域中的技术人员很容易在不脱离本发明精神和范围的 情况下进行进一步的改进和完善,因此本发明只受到本发明权利要求的内容和范围的限 制,其意图涵盖所有包括在由所附权利要求所限定的本发明精神和范围内的备选方案和等 同方案。
【主权项】
1. 一种基于单波段火焰探测方法,其特征在于,该方法包括: 第一步骤,采集经过滤光处理后的滤光图像; 第二步骤,对滤光图像进行帧间分析,获取候选区域; 第三步骤,对候选区域进行筛选; 第四步骤,将剩余的候选区域作为火焰检测图像并输出。2. 如权利要求1所述的方法,所述第一步骤中滤光处理的滤光波段为TH_WF,TH_WF的取 值范围为760~900nm〇3. 如权利要求1所述的方法,其特征在于,所述第二步骤中帧差分析包括: 对前后两帧图像做帧差处理,获得帧差图像; 设置阈值TH_FD,对帧差图像进行二值化处理,得到一系列的帧差二值化图像; 选择TM个连续的帧差二值化图像做"与"操作,得到融合的帧差二值化图像; 对融合的帧差二值化图像进行连通区域处理,获得一系列连通区域,即为候选区域; 其中,所述TH_FD的取值范围为5~30,TM的取值范围为5~30。4. 如权利要求1所述的方法,其特征在于,所述第三步骤中对候选区域进行筛选包括: 面积筛选步骤,计算候选区域的面积,滤除面积小于阈值TH_CR的候选区域; 移动速率筛选步骤,计算候选区域的水平移动速率Vx和垂直移动速率^,滤除 心_K*,錄-或者V4顶-Lv,4J的候选区域; 其中,所述面积筛选步骤中计算候选区域的面积,即统计候选区域内的像素点的个数, TH_CR的取值范围为20~40,Th_Vmin的取值范围为0.1~0.3,Th_Vmax的取值范围为0.3~ 0.6,且Th_V min<Th_Vmax〇5. 如权利要求4所述的方法,所述移动速率筛选步骤中计算候选区域的水平移动速率^ 和垂直移动速率Vy具体如下: 对于相邻两帧图像中候选区域€〇1(1,7)、€〇2(1,7),分别计算€〇1(1,7)、€〇2(1,7)的质心 (父1八1)、(父2,¥2),公式为:仰1&,7)402(^7)分别为相邻两帧图像中候选区域&, 7)的亮度值14分别为候选区 域的长度和宽度; 计算候选区域的水平移动速:?和垂直移动速率6. 基于单波段的火焰检测装置,其特征在于,该装置包括: 采集模块,用于采集经过滤光处理后的滤光图像; 候选区域获取模块,用于对滤光图像进行帧间分析,获取候选区域; 候选区域筛选模块,用于对候选区域进行筛选; 火焰检测图像获取模块,用于将剩余的候选区域作为火焰检测图像并输出。7. 如权利要求6所述的装置,所述采集模块包括相机和滤光元件,滤光元件安装在相机 的镜头和C⑶之间。8. 如权利要求7所述的装置,所述滤光元件的滤光波段为TH_WF,TH_WF的取值范围为 760~900nm。9. 如权利要求6所述的装置,所述候选区域获取模块中帧差分析包括: 帧差处理模块,用于对前后两帧图像做帧差处理,获得帧差图像; 二值化处理模块,用于设置阈值TH_FD,对帧差图像进行二值化处理,得到一系列的帧 差二值化图像; 图像融合模块,用于选择TM个连续的帧差二值化图像做"与"操作,得到融合的帧差二 值化图像; 连通区域处理模块,用于对融合的帧差二值化图像进行连通区域处理,获得一系列连 通区域,即为候选区域; 其中,所述TH_FD的取值范围为5~30,TM取值范围为5~30。10. 如权利要求6所述的装置,其特征在于,所述候选区域筛选模块中对候选区域进行 筛选包括: 面积筛选模块,用于计算候选区域的面积,滤除面积小于阈值TH_CR的候选区域; 移动速率筛选模块,用于计算候选区域的水平移动速率^和垂直移动速率^,滤除 y^[ThJ\…" ]或者r, g [77? _ K,训,' ΓΑ _匕上]的候选区域; 其中,所述面积筛选模块中计算候选区域的面积,即统计候选区域内的像素点的个数, TH_CR的取值范围为20~40,Th_Vmin的取值范围为0.1~0.3,Th_Vmax的取值范围为0.3~ 0.6,且Th_V min<Th_Vmax〇11. 如权利要求10所述的装置,所述移动速率筛选模块中计算候选区域的水平移动速 率^和垂直移动速率^包括: 质心获取模块,对于相邻两帧图像中候选区域f Di (X,y)、f D2 (X,y),分别计算f Di (X,y)、 fD2(x,y)的质心 χ~ι κ-i x~i y=ix~i v-iI ? -_,.fDi(x,y)、fD2(x,y)分别为相邻两帧图像中候选区域(x,y)的亮度 值,M、N分别为候选区域的长度和宽度; 移动速率计算模块,计算候选区域的水平移动速率1和垂直移动速率
【文档编号】G06T7/20GK105869183SQ201610176995
【公开日】2016年8月17日
【申请日】2016年3月25日
【发明人】谢静, 班华忠
【申请人】北京智芯原动科技有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1